Regulatory-Associated Protein of mTOR

An adaptor protein component of the MECHANISTIC TARGET OF RAPAMYCIN COMPLEX 1 that forms stoichiometric complexes with TOR KINASES, which it negatively regulates. It functions as a positive regulator of RIBOSOMAL PROTEIN S6 KINASES.
